Although approaching to the well-known complaint called croup, it differs in some respects, particularly by the presence of the following symptoms:—Painful deglutition, partial swelling of the fauces, and a perpetually increasing difficulty of breathing. The mouth of the larynx, or aperture by which air is admitted into the lungs, is so much narrowed, that the vital functions are actually extinguished by the stricture. And yet the apparent inflammation in the throat is so inconsiderable, that upon a superficial observation, it would hardly be noticed; but in its progress the voice is changed, becomes altogether suppressed, and the disease terminates in suffocation.


BAILLIE.

CHAPTER V.

The mother of Dr. Baillie was the sister of John Hunter, the celebrated anatomist and physiologist. From the university of Glasgow, he went, in 1780, to Balliol College, Oxford, where he graduated, and settled early in London, under the immediate superintendence of his other maternal uncle, Dr. William Hunter. Following the example of his distinguished relations, he became himself a teacher of anatomy in 1785; and he continued to lecture for nearly twenty years. In delivering his lectures, he expressed himself with great clearness, and conveyed his information to his pupils in the most simple and intelligible language. For this talent he was greatly indebted to the assiduous instruction of his uncle, who spared no pains in cultivating in his young pupil a habit of ready and exact explanation; and was accustomed to teach him in this manner: “Matthew, do you know any thing of to-day’s lecture?” demanded Dr. Hunter of his nephew. “Yes, sir, I hope I do.” “Well, then, demonstrate to me.” “I will go and fetch the preparation, sir.” “Oh! no, Matthew, if you know the subject really, you will know it whether the preparation be absent or present.” Dr. Hunter then stood with his back to the fire, and his nephew demonstrated. Thus was the young student encouraged by approbation and assistance, or immediately convicted of loose and inaccurate information.

His work on morbid anatomy, published in 1793, was dedicated by him to his friend Dr. David Pitcairn, as a testimony of high esteem for his character, and of gratitude for many kind offices. The splendid engravings which were afterwards published as illustrations of this work, were alike creditable to his own taste and liberality, and to the state of the arts in this country.

When I passed from the hands of Pitcairn into the possession of Dr. Baillie, I ceased to be considered any longer as a necessary appendage of the profession, and consequently the opportunities I enjoyed of seeing the world, or even of knowing much about the state of physic, were very greatly abridged, and but of rare occurrence.

Once only was I introduced into a large party. It was on a Sunday evening, when I was taken to one of the scientific meetings, held at the house of Sir Joseph Banks in Soho Square. How different from the gay conversaziones in Ormond Street, in the spacious library of Dr. Mead, filled with splendid books, and ornamented with antiques of the most costly description! On entering the house of Sir Joseph, I was ushered up a sort of back staircase, and introduced into two gloomy apartments, in the farther corner of the first of which sat the President of the Royal Society, wearing the red riband of the Order of the Bath, in a gouty chair. Here I was passed from one to the other, and considered rather as a curious relic, than regarded, as I was wont to be, as the support and ornament of the faculty. My only consolation arose, as I was handed about, from the observation, which it was impossible not to make, that among the philosophers present there was a great proportion of medical men, who examined me, as may be supposed, with more than ordinary interest. Among others, I did not escape the keen and scrutinizing eye of a physician who then held the office of Secretary to the Royal Society, who early relinquished the practice of his profession for other pursuits, but whose name is identified with the history of modern chemistry, and will live as long as science shall be cultivated.
